Profile interpretation
What the reported data says about Brown Joseph Sch
Brown Joseph Sch is a public elementary school serving grades KG–08 in Philadelphia. It is one of 220 current school records connected to Philadelphia City SD. NCES reports 441 students for 2024–25.
Among 1,624 elementary schools in Pennsylvania with comparable records, this school is close in size than the reported median of 416.5 students. Its enrollment is at approximately the 56th percentile for that peer group. Size describes the campus, not instructional quality.
The reported student–teacher ratio is 14.2:1, above the Pennsylvania median of 12.9:1 for the same school level. This ratio uses total enrollment and teacher FTE; it is not an average classroom headcount and can be affected by special programs or part-time staffing.
The two largest reported race and ethnicity groups are Hispanic or Latino (36.7%) and Black (34%). English learners represent 11.3% of enrollment. Students served under IDEA represent 18.2%. These figures help families understand who the school serves; they are not rating inputs.
The 2021–22 civil-rights collection reports access to gifted and talented programming. Program availability changes, so families should confirm the current catalog and participation rules directly with the school.
